Implementing SEO Solutions: Best Practices for Speed Optimization
Optimizing website speed is a critical component of SEO solutions best practices, directly influencing user experience and search engine rankings. To enhance performance, focus on content optimization for voice assistants, ensuring quick loading times across all devices. Implement caching mechanisms to serve static assets instantly; utilize content delivery networks (CDNs) to distribute content globally, reducing latency. Additionally, minifying code and optimizing images improves page speed, making your site more appealing to both users and search engines.

One key area to refine is the metadata associated with each page. Well-optimized meta tags not only improve click-through rates (CTRs) but also send strong signals to search engines about your content’s relevance. For instance, a study by SEMrush revealed that pages with tailored meta titles and descriptions consistently outperformed their generic counterparts in both organic visibility and CTR.
